Output ea073e616722ee17bf54396b5db96195239ffb0414f54c2c6472b05fca32cb59: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d12fb95cd22ab9608a6a4609dae4f39b04ca3e71
address
bc1q6yhmjhxj92ukpzn2gcya4e8nnvzv50n3gleusm
transaction
ea073e616722ee17bf54396b5db96195239ffb0414f54c2c6472b05fca32cb59
confirmations
216300
spent
true